Apple's New iPhone 17 Offers a Perfect Balance of Power and Affordability

For the first time in many years, using the new iPhone 17 doesn't feel like a significant downgrade from its pricier Pro models. The phone has finally brought one of the best features of modern smartphones to its base model: a super-smooth 120Hz screen, which significantly enhances the overall user experience.

The iPhone 17 starts at the same Β£799 as its predecessor and still offers a lot of value for money, particularly when compared to other iPhones in the lineup. While it may not look drastically different from last year's model, this phone marks a big year for the standard Apple smartphone with several meaningful upgrades.

One of the standout features is the 120Hz "Pro Motion" screen technology, which doubles the refresh rate to make scrolling and animations much smoother and more responsive. This feature has been common in rival smartphones for years but was previously reserved for Pro models only.

Another notable upgrade is the always-on display feature, which shows the time, widgets, and notifications while the phone is idle. The iPhone 17 also runs the same iOS 26 with Apple's new glass-like interface design as the rest of the iPhone lineup.

In terms of specifications, the iPhone 17 features a 6.3-inch Super Retina XDR OLED screen with a fast A19 chip that provides great performance for its price point. The phone also has up to 512GB of storage, making it an excellent choice for those who need more space.

The camera on the back is dual-cam setup consisting of two 48-megapixel cameras and an 18MP front-facing camera, which is an upgrade from previous models. While it may not have a telephoto lens, it still delivers solid results in various lighting conditions.

One major con of the iPhone 17 is its lack of a telephoto camera option, but overall, this phone feels like a great choice for those looking to upgrade their standard iPhone experience without breaking the bank.

With its rapid 120Hz screen, good dual-camera setup, and at least 256GB storage, the iPhone 17 offers an excellent balance of power and affordability. It may not be the most powerful or feature-rich device out there, but it's a solid choice for those seeking a reliable and user-friendly smartphone experience.

However, if you need advanced camera features like telephoto lens capabilities or extreme zooms, then the standard iPhone 17 might not be the best option for you.

Overall, the iPhone 17 is a great addition to Apple's lineup, providing an affordable entry point for users who want to experience the company's renowned user interface and performance.
